Helvic Pier

A bustling Helvic Pier on a summers day with people looking at the boats from the pier. The two fishing boats in the foreground are Taobh A Ghleanna (built at Killybegs in 1959), on the outside and probably The Vega which was registered at Waterford on the inside. In the background is the Helvick Lifeboat and halfway up the hill can be seen Helvick Lodge. The two old men in the background are Nicholas Fitzgerald (left) and Mike Harty (right).

No: TT24
Photographer: Tobin, Tom
Date: Circa 1958
